Understanding Micro Gear Pumps

Micro gear pumps for medical applications are designed to offer a high degree of precision in the volumetric metering of fluids. These pumps typically consist of two or more gears that mesh together, creating seals that facilitate efficient fluid transfer. Their compact size enables integration into small medical devices, which is increasingly important in modern healthcare settings.

Benefits of Micro Gear Pumps for Medical Purposes

  1. Accuracy: Micro gear pumps deliver consistent flow rates, ensuring the precise metering of medications and other fluids.
  2. Compact Design: The small footprint of these pumps makes them ideal for handheld devices or equipment requiring space-saving solutions.
  3. Versatility: They can handle various fluid types, including viscous liquids, making them suitable for a wide range of applications.
  4. Low Pulsation: The design allows for smooth, continuous flow with minimal pulsation, which is particularly important in sensitive applications.

Key Applications of Micro Gear Pumps in Medical Devices

Micro gear pumps find their use in several critical areas within the medical field. The following are some key applications:

1. Infusion Systems

Infusion systems frequently utilize micro gear pumps for accurate drug delivery. These systems require precise control over fluid flow, which is essential for administering medications, nutrients, or other therapeutic agents.

  • Common uses include:
    • Chemotherapy administration
    • Pain management
    • Nutritional support

2. Blood Management Devices

In blood management, micro gear pumps are integral to devices that process and store blood. They help maintain blood integrity by minimizing damage during transfer and ensuring a smooth flow.

  • Applications include:
    • Blood collection tubes
    • Blood pumps for transfusions
    • Hemodialysis machines

3. Drug Delivery Devices

Micro gear pumps are essential components in drug delivery systems that require precise dosages. Their ability to control minute volumes enables targeted therapies.

  • Examples include:
    • Insulin pumps for diabetes management
    • Auto-injectors for emergency medication delivery

4. Laboratory Equipment

In various laboratory applications, micro gear pumps assist in handling samples and reagents. Their accuracy and reliability are crucial in research and diagnostic testing.

  • Typical uses encompass:
    • Sample handling in analytical instruments
    • Chemical dosing in diagnostic assays

Common Problems and Solutions

While micro gear pumps for medical applications are efficient, users may encounter certain challenges:

  • Problem: Inconsistent Flow Rates

    • Solution: Ensure regular maintenance and calibration of the pump to maintain consistent performance.
  • Problem: Clogging

    • Solution: Use properly filtered fluids and clean the system regularly to prevent blockages.
  • Problem: Noise During Operation

    • Solution: Check for mechanical wear in the gears and replace components as necessary to reduce operational noise.
